Output ddac2652758cedde4cab07ab524d900d1d9928808dc38d5c36b1c49bf1a56346:0

value
3084757
script pubkey
OP_0 OP_PUSHBYTES_20 5d77b291cfdff8d65653f0a1bc8114606517975d
address
bc1qt4mm9yw0mludv4jn7zsmeqg5vpj3096aq7czln
transaction
ddac2652758cedde4cab07ab524d900d1d9928808dc38d5c36b1c49bf1a56346